Title: Inventor Spotlight: Martin Laermann

Introduction

Martin Laermann is an innovative inventor based in Clarkston, Michigan, who holds two patents related to exhaust systems for internal combustion engines. His work demonstrates a commitment to advancing automotive technology, improving efficiency and emissions monitoring.

Latest Patents

Laermann's latest patents focus on enhancing exhaust systems. The first patent, titled "Exhaust System for Internal Combustion Engine," introduces a comprehensive solution for diesel particulate filter (DPF) failure detection and monitoring of non-methane hydrocarbons (NMHC). This system includes a main exhaust duct and a secondary exhaust line, ensuring optimal exhaust gas flow. Key components include an oxidation catalyst and a main particulate filter, with an additional monitoring particulate filter located downstream for enhanced performance and monitoring capabilities.

The second patent, "Exhaust Control System for an Internal Combustion Engine," outlines an advanced control mechanism utilizing multiple actuators to manage various engine parameters. This system is equipped with numerous sensors that provide real-time data on engine operating conditions. Each actuator is governed by a PID controller, optimizing performance through a feedback loop and a distribution function circuit that adjusts inputs based on error signals, ensuring efficient engine functionality.

Career Highlights

Throughout his career, Martin has worked with notable companies in the automotive industry, including FEV GmbH and AM General LLC. His experience has enriched his understanding of engine systems, leading to significant advancements in exhaust technology.

Collaborations

In his professional journey, Martin has collaborated with talented individuals such as Marek Tatur and Dean Tomazic. These collaborations have contributed to the innovative nature of his patents and have fostered a rich exchange of ideas and technical expertise.
